We compared two versions of phone SoCs: 8 cores 2800MHz Qualcomm Snapdragon 685 vs. 8 cores 1800MHz Qualcomm Snapdragon 632 . You will find out which processor performs better in benchmark tests, key specifications, power consumption, and more.

Main Differences

Qualcomm Snapdragon 685 Advantages
Better graphics card performance FLOPS (0.2432 TFLOPS vs 0.1248 TFLOPS )
Higher Frequency (2800MHz vs 1800MHz)
More modern manufacturing process (6nm vs 14nm)
Released 4 years and 9 months late
